Hazardous Tree Assessment & Removal
Some trees look fine from the road but tell a different story up close—bark beetle galleries, trunk cracks, and heavy leans toward roofs or play areas. We inspect crown, trunk, root flare, and soil to decide if hazardous tree removal makes the most sense for safety.
Over barns, fences, and sheds near Shay Meadow, we might crane sections over the structure or dismantle by rope and saddle. Our crew rigs controlled lowers so your property stays intact during technical tree removal where there’s no margin for error.
We document the defects and explain options clearly, including pruning alternatives when that’s safer or more practical. When failure risk is high, we move forward with measured cuts and a clear tree risk assessment so you know exactly why and how we’re doing it.
Wood can be bucked for your rack, chipped for trails, or hauled to green waste depending on your plan. We sweep, rake, and magnet-scan for nails or old wire so your site looks good after full tree removal and cleanup.

Did You Know?
Erwin Lake isn’t a big blue lake most days—it’s a historic meadow basin that hints at water with each shift in the valley. Old-timers talk about the ranching roots here, and you still see the fences and open space shaping Erwin Lake history along those broad flats.
Just up the way, the Baldwin Lake basin hosts rare pebble plain habitats with tough little wildflowers adapted to thin soils. That’s why careful access and clean work matter when we stage gear near the Baldwin Lake Ecological Reserve and other sensitive spots.

Local Service FAQs
How do you remove a tree close to my cabin on Erwin Ranch Road without damage?
We use controlled rigging to lower limbs in small pieces, protect surfaces with mats, and set a clear drop zone. When needed, a compact crane lifts sections over the roof to a safe landing spot. This method keeps the structure safe during technical tree removal.
Can you grind a stump near my septic line off East End Road?
Yes, we mark utilities first, then grind with a shallow approach near sensitive lines and a deeper pass away from them. The goal is a smooth grade without disturbing your system. We’ll advise the best depth for stump grinding around utilities.
What if my leaning pine is touching a service drop along Big Bear Boulevard?
We coordinate with the utility to de-energize or shield as required before any cuts are made. Our crew then sections the tree with ropes so nothing swings into the line. This careful sequence is standard for hazard tree removal near conductors.
